通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python安装出错如何重新安装

python安装出错如何重新安装

在Python安装出错时,您可以通过以下几个步骤来重新安装Python:检查并卸载现有安装、清理注册表和环境变量、下载最新安装包、重新安装Python。 这些步骤将帮助您确保一个干净的安装环境,避免因残留文件或设置导致的重复错误。下面我将详细解释这些步骤。

一、检查并卸载现有安装

在开始重新安装之前,首先需要检查并卸载现有的Python安装。这样可以确保之前的安装文件不会干扰新的安装过程。

1. 使用操作系统的卸载功能

在Windows中,可以通过“控制面板”找到“程序和功能”,然后找到Python,右键点击并选择“卸载”。

在macOS中,可以通过Finder找到Python应用程序,拖动到废纸篓中进行删除。

在Linux中,可以使用包管理器进行卸载,例如在Ubuntu中,可以使用以下命令:

sudo apt-get remove --purge python3

2. 删除残留文件

在卸载之后,还需要确保删除残留的文件和文件夹。检查以下路径并删除相关文件:

  • Windows: C:\Users\<YourUsername>\AppData\Local\Programs\Python
  • macOS: /Library/Frameworks/Python.framework/Versions/
  • Linux: /usr/local/lib/python3.x/

二、清理注册表和环境变量

在Windows系统中,Python的安装信息会记录在注册表中,因此有必要清理注册表以避免冲突。

1. 清理注册表

打开“注册表编辑器”(按下Win+R键,输入regedit并回车)。然后导航到以下路径并删除与Python相关的项:

  • HKEY_CURRENT_USER\Software\Python
  • HKEY_LOCAL_MACHINE\SOFTWARE\Python

注意:操作注册表时要小心,错误的修改可能会导致系统不稳定。

2. 清理环境变量

确保环境变量中没有残留的Python路径。右键点击“此电脑”,选择“属性”,然后选择“高级系统设置”,点击“环境变量”。在“系统变量”中找到并编辑Path变量,删除与Python相关的路径。

三、下载最新安装包

访问Python的官方网站(https://www.python.org/)下载最新版本的安装包。确保下载与您的操作系统和架构(32位或64位)匹配的版本。

四、重新安装Python

按照以下步骤重新安装Python:

1. 运行安装程序

双击下载的安装包,运行安装程序。在安装向导中,选择“自定义安装”,这样可以更好地控制安装选项。

2. 选择安装选项

在安装选项中,可以选择是否添加Python到环境变量,是否安装pip包管理器等。建议勾选“Add Python to PATH”选项,这将自动将Python添加到系统的环境变量中。

3. 安装完成后验证

安装完成后,打开命令提示符或终端,输入以下命令以验证安装是否成功:

python --version

pip --version

如果能够正确显示Python和pip的版本信息,说明安装成功。

五、处理常见安装错误

在安装过程中,可能会遇到一些常见错误。以下是一些常见错误及其解决方法:

1. 缺少权限

如果在安装过程中提示缺少权限,可以尝试以管理员身份运行安装程序。在Windows中,右键点击安装包,选择“以管理员身份运行”。

2. 缺少依赖包

某些情况下,Python的安装可能需要一些系统依赖包。例如,在Linux系统中,可以使用包管理器安装所需的依赖包:

sudo apt-get update

sudo apt-get install -y build-essential libssl-dev libffi-dev python3-dev

3. 网络连接问题

如果下载过程中遇到网络连接问题,可以尝试使用离线安装包,或者从其他可靠的镜像站点下载Python安装包。

六、安装后配置

重新安装Python后,可以进行一些配置以提高开发效率和体验。

1. 配置虚拟环境

使用虚拟环境可以隔离不同项目的依赖,避免包版本冲突。可以使用以下命令创建和激活虚拟环境:

python -m venv myenv

source myenv/bin/activate # 在Windows中使用 myenv\Scripts\activate

2. 安装常用包

根据项目需求,可以安装一些常用的包,例如numpy, pandas, requests等。可以使用pip进行安装:

pip install numpy pandas requests

3. 配置IDE

选择一个合适的IDE(如PyCharm, VS Code等),并进行相关配置,例如设置Python解释器路径、安装相关插件等。

七、总结

重新安装Python的过程中,需要确保彻底卸载现有安装、清理残留文件和注册表、下载最新安装包并按步骤安装。遇到问题时,可以参考常见错误的解决方法。同时,安装完成后,可以进行一些配置以提高开发效率。通过以上步骤,您可以解决Python安装出错的问题,并顺利重新安装Python。

相关问答FAQs:

如何确定我的Python安装出现了什么错误?
在重新安装Python之前,了解具体的错误信息是非常重要的。可以通过查看命令行中的错误提示,或者在安装过程中产生的日志文件来获取详细信息。常见的错误包括路径问题、权限不足和依赖包缺失。确保您记录下这些错误信息,有助于更好地解决问题。

重新安装Python时需要注意哪些步骤?
在重新安装Python时,建议首先卸载之前的版本。可以通过控制面板的“程序和功能”选项进行卸载。此外,建议在卸载后检查是否有残留文件,特别是在安装目录下和用户目录中的配置文件。在重新安装时,请确保从官方网站下载最新的稳定版本,并根据系统类型(32位或64位)选择合适的安装包。

如何确保我的Python环境配置正确?
在重新安装Python后,配置环境变量是确保其正常工作的关键步骤。您可以将Python的安装路径添加到系统的PATH环境变量中,这样可以方便地在命令行中运行Python。安装完成后,可以通过命令行输入python --version来检查安装是否成功。此外,建议安装虚拟环境工具,如venvvirtualenv,以便在不同项目之间管理依赖库,避免版本冲突。

相关文章